It was what I thought, the WBC had gone sky high yesterday. So that is why
he wanted me in this bright and early this morning. He ran more blood work,
and chest xray.
Guess what, chest xray is clear, blood work is back down to normal.
He thought he blew it on Monday and didn't spot something because of the
really high WBC they got yesterday.
So we got to talking about it. I asked him could it be the dehydration.
Seeing how I have my period and flooded the bed yesterday. Therefore
dehydrating me more than I was already. He said yes that could do it because
when dehydrated, the blood is more concentrated so will show higher reading.
He looked at the electrolytes, and said yes it was showing dehydration but
today I am more hydrated.
I know the answer was prayers, but I do know that some of my dehydration
problem has been a problem for years now. So here is what I think about
that. I have gone in before they run the WBC see it is high, think I have an
infection when I really don't and given me antiboitics. So then I get
allergic to them. So now I can't take any. It came from overuse of
antiboitics when I really didn't need them.
But at least now I know that, so the next time I have high WBC, then I can
say oh no we are not going that route, you rehydrate me and redo the test.
